summ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--dev-cpp/libjsonpp/Manifest2
-rw-r--r--dev-cpp/libjsonpp/libjsonpp-0.12.0.ebuild26
-rw-r--r--dev-vcs/git-extras/git-extras-4.6.0.ebuild25
-rw-r--r--dev-vcs/git-extras/git-extras-4.7.0.ebuild25
4 files changed, 28 insertions, 50 deletions
diff --git a/dev-cpp/libjsonpp/Manifest b/dev-cpp/libjsonpp/Manifest
index e30a68e..d3d55b0 100644
--- a/dev-cpp/libjsonpp/Manifest
+++ b/dev-cpp/libjsonpp/Manifest
@@ -1,4 +1,6 @@
DIST libjsonpp-0.11.0.tar.xz 11544 BLAKE2B 3eae6cc32cd41f3f2c52cf96e80b05497c86d07043fb2f6487ea50156d2c6f8b0c3f46f26a4f8fad6a5bde2813f7af3c6ea914610e505651edddb3a5fdd6e1a7 SHA512 9090bd6d9b7916c1c6bdd917b28b870fd1cbdfcc3f586447571d7a3c058e398aeaf9695b4b08e432bded399e6e4c9466005fcd9ad9d4cee774eb29940cfd0672
DIST libjsonpp-0.11.2.tar.xz 11636 BLAKE2B 9c65348803b1c367b3a9970eb15f4522c76fc286c9bb120081d7906c38c403978a11bdc4588520b22ff06511a69054f458c7b0721c0a78a3acf01222dc528115 SHA512 bd3e1d5b2d795636c39ec5a706946201129c2f1c35ddd73a63c22277f3d2f588f63f78b653eeffe17a100651c7d53d744e89a7eae7b87c26d349edead74f99d8
+DIST libjsonpp-0.12.0.tar.xz 11968 BLAKE2B 76eca9c7c8e99ab75187e734344364ef5dcb7d21d4ea7f9e0268ef04395cc5cfe98fc7d9c9f6352978e94451e758fb8be2ed3e01628f3193479a218947259075 SHA512 5506f87bc3982e57e2f2e2e9f1991b850bcf78d4b24664515e41564ce74144cd6640ce773745c46b81b50727c5dfd5dbc70a5f0cab0427816b58da7f63eb13b6
EBUILD libjsonpp-0.11.0.ebuild 462 BLAKE2B c8686242e89d0fb0a2c8672055bd51da7a8cba8ce4dd84c4fab142e46e3994235f43417e40d6f14c38a3b6779afa0f5ae37e3dbff1b47bc4d017f9ae5bc82b62 SHA512 c3c99e428518b3ecc7e1c610fa58328ecaada323455c296b8852601e7fc902cdcf94901fee17298a8461d26864874cb450f1b0c6e4c01df7474b8e10051e8ee6
EBUILD libjsonpp-0.11.2.ebuild 444 BLAKE2B 456243a286bd5938c39d21df875823e572deeb959bc58f5e0046488f254c6b1eea8aac33e70dce01c2911649c6a84beacc9164d6cf6a90cc83621a1806c8cdb5 SHA512 ffd8e89e88945ab14427fb8ab63ac20312290ea4f9568bbe4b6c978aa73bc4d2bce09b4c2b954ddc6c32e4383a6abd976892196c21957a97e2ef05dfde0acb7e
+EBUILD libjsonpp-0.12.0.ebuild 444 BLAKE2B 456243a286bd5938c39d21df875823e572deeb959bc58f5e0046488f254c6b1eea8aac33e70dce01c2911649c6a84beacc9164d6cf6a90cc83621a1806c8cdb5 SHA512 ffd8e89e88945ab14427fb8ab63ac20312290ea4f9568bbe4b6c978aa73bc4d2bce09b4c2b954ddc6c32e4383a6abd976892196c21957a97e2ef05dfde0acb7e
diff --git a/dev-cpp/libjsonpp/libjsonpp-0.12.0.ebuild b/dev-cpp/libjsonpp/libjsonpp-0.12.0.ebuild
new file mode 100644
index 0000000..d77c2f9
--- /dev/null
+++ b/dev-cpp/libjsonpp/libjsonpp-0.12.0.ebuild
@@ -0,0 +1,26 @@
+EAPI="6"
+inherit bjam
+
+DESCRIPTION="Lightweight native C++ JSON library"
+HOMEPAGE="http://libjsonpp.randomdan.homeip.net/"
+
+SRC_URI="https://git.randomdan.homeip.net/repo/${PN}/snapshot/${P}.tar.xz"
+LICENSE="MIT"
+SLOT="0"
+KEYWORDS="x86 amd64"
+IUSE=""
+
+DEPEND="dev-cpp/glibmm"
+RDEPEND="${DEPEND}
+ sys-devel/flex
+ dev-util/boost-build"
+
+src_compile() {
+ bjambuild libjsonpp//jsonpp
+}
+
+src_install() {
+ bjaminstall libjsonpp//install \
+ -i ""
+}
+
diff --git a/dev-vcs/git-extras/git-extras-4.6.0.ebuild b/dev-vcs/git-extras/git-extras-4.6.0.ebuild
deleted file mode 100644
index b9ecf03..0000000
--- a/dev-vcs/git-extras/git-extras-4.6.0.ebuild
+++ /dev/null
@@ -1,25 +0,0 @@
-# Copyright 1999-2015 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: $
-
-EAPI=5
-inherit eutils
-
-DESCRIPTION="GIT utilities -- repo summary, repl, changelog population, author commit percentages and more"
-HOMEPAGE="https://github.com/tj/git-extras"
-SRC_URI="https://github.com/tj/${PN}/archive/${PV}.tar.gz -> ${P}.tar.gz"
-
-LICENSE=""
-SLOT="0"
-KEYWORDS="amd64"
-IUSE=""
-
-DEPEND=""
-RDEPEND="${DEPEND}"
-
-src_compile() { echo; }
-
-src_install() {
- emake install PREFIX="${D}/usr" SYSCONFDIR="${D}/etc"
-}
-
diff --git a/dev-vcs/git-extras/git-extras-4.7.0.ebuild b/dev-vcs/git-extras/git-extras-4.7.0.ebuild
deleted file mode 100644
index b9ecf03..0000000
--- a/dev-vcs/git-extras/git-extras-4.7.0.ebuild
+++ /dev/null
@@ -1,25 +0,0 @@
-# Copyright 1999-2015 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: $
-
-EAPI=5
-inherit eutils
-
-DESCRIPTION="GIT utilities -- repo summary, repl, changelog population, author commit percentages and more"
-HOMEPAGE="https://github.com/tj/git-extras"
-SRC_URI="https://github.com/tj/${PN}/archive/${PV}.tar.gz -> ${P}.tar.gz"
-
-LICENSE=""
-SLOT="0"
-KEYWORDS="amd64"
-IUSE=""
-
-DEPEND=""
-RDEPEND="${DEPEND}"
-
-src_compile() { echo; }
-
-src_install() {
- emake install PREFIX="${D}/usr" SYSCONFDIR="${D}/etc"
-}
-